Who we are
KeyNest is a fast-growing technology company with around 50 people and offices in Paris and London, although most of our team works remotely. We’re best known for our convenient Airbnb key holding service which welcomes millions of guests every year, but we have an innovative product line spanning hardware, software, and services, which are sold to B2B and B2C customers across 18 countries and a dozen industries.
The role: Content Specialist
We are looking for an ambitious, committed Content Specialist to bring to life a number of campaigns with compelling, on‑brand copy, visual and video content. You’ll have to quickly grasp how prospects perceive their own needs and position our product or service accordingly, across multiple KeyNest offerings, target industries, and geographies.
You’ll be working closely with both of founders as well as our talented digital marketing manager, who will support you with the technical implementation of campaigns, and we are keen to give you space to be creative whilst we share our knowledge of our target industries.
This is a high‑commitment role. One of the founders will invest significant time to train you, together craft a career development path for you inside KeyNest, and coach you to progress. We don’t hesitate to promote and reward high‑achieving individuals and provide you the tools needed to realise you full potential. We believe that high job satisfaction leads to high performance, and we are proud of our very low staff turnover rate.
We are more interested in you than your location. On‑site working options are available out of our London and Paris offices. Fully remote working is also possible from any European time zone, but you should be able to come to London office for at least one week during the first month.
